"How can you have such joy after all the hard places you've walked through?" Your strength will only take you so far. If you want to cross the finish line, God's strength is the only resource that will not fail. Barb and Bill Hollace are just two ordinary people who entered an extraordinary path through the medical field. Bill earned the title of Miracle Man as God did what seemed impossible. Life changed. The loss of her forever love. A life-changing health diagnosis. There was only one choice. Trust God. God delivered her and promises to do the same for you. God's Goodness on the Glory Road is a daily devotional written by a widow who found hope and joy on her journey forward. This story is one of tests and trials, growth and grace. You are invited to look for God's goodness in your own life through the context of God's word. You may be on your own healing journey or walking alongside a loved one who is suffering. Maybe you have questions, or even doubts and fears. God is big enough to handle all of this and more.

More About Barnes and Noble at MarketFair Shoppes

Barnes & Noble does business -- big business -- by the book. As the #1 bookseller in the US, it operates about 720 Barnes & Noble superstores (selling books, music, movies, and gifts) throughout all 50 US states and Washington, DC. The stores are typically 10,000 to 60,000 sq. ft. and stock between 60,000 and 200,000 book titles. Many of its locations contain Starbucks cafes, as well as music departments that carry more than 30,000 titles.
